KPMG's Tax Incentives Practice (TIP) brings together engineers and tax professionals to help innovative organizations access Canada's Scientific Research and Experimental Development (SR&ED) program. As demand for advisory support in complex software-driven R&D environments continues to grow, this team is seeking a Manager with deep technical experience and strong client advisory capability.

In this role, you will work directly with senior client stakeholders in software and technology organizations, while leading engagements, reviewing technical analyses, and guiding teams in the preparation of SR&ED claims for sophisticated development initiatives.

What you will do
  • Lead SR&ED client engagements for software-focused organizations, ensuring quality, timeliness, and alignment with program requirements
  • Advise clients on the eligibility of complex software development activities, including architectures, integrations, and advanced algorithms
  • Review and refine technical narratives and documentation supporting SR&ED claims
  • Manage and coach engagement teams, providing guidance on technical analysis, client interactions, and documentation standards
  • Build and maintain relationships with client stakeholders, including CTOs, engineering leaders, and product teams
  • Identify opportunities to expand engagements through additional advisory services and deeper client penetration
  • Monitor changes in SR&ED policy and emerging technology trends to inform client advice and internal best practices
  • Participating in project planning, resource management, and engagement economics
What you bring to the role
  • Undergraduate or graduate deg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related discipline
  • Progressive experience in software development, IT R&D, or technical consulting environments
  • Strong understanding of software architectures, development methodologies, and modern technology stacks
  • Experience with SR&ED or similar innovation incentive programs is preferred
  • Demonstrated ability to manage client relationships and lead project delivery
  • Proven experience reviewing technical work and providing constructive guidance to team members
  • Ability to translate complex technical concepts into clear, defensible documentation
  • Experience managing multiple concurrent engagements with competing priorities

KPMG BC Region Pay Range Information
The expected base salary range for this position is $85,000 to $128,500 and may be eligible for bonus awards. The determination of an applicant's base salary within this range is based on the individual's location, skills & competencies, and unique qualifications.
